IB stationery - Rules and Conventions
Structured exam papers: ex. science papers. Answers are written in the question booklet. These are
named “Question/Answers booklets”.
Unstructured exam papers: ex. English papers. Answers are written in “4 page Answers Booklets”. These
booklets do not contain any questions.
Candidates will not be provided with rough/scratch paper on which to write a draft for an answer or for
working out or planning an answer. For unstructured exam papers, the working out must be written in the
Answer booklet. For structured examination paper the working out can be written on the examination
paper, supplemented with an extra Answer booklet (if necessary). If a candidate does not want any draft
work to be marked, a line must be drawn through that work.
Graph paper can only be used for drawing graphs and should not be used for text and drafting responses.
IB stationery - 4 page answer booklets
Answer booklets are designed in a special format for easy scanning, OCR and e-marking. From summer
2013 onwards, the majority of the exam papers are scanned and marked online. It is imperative to only
Year 13 Leavers Booklet Exams Office
6
use black or blue pen for writing your answers and a soft pencil for drawing graphs. Colour pencils are
only allowed in geography examinations. Highlighters are forbidden in answer booklets.
Special format for recording question numbers on 4 page answer booklets: You must ensure your session
number and names are entered on the first page. Indicate the question number in the pair boxes on the
left before you start writing your answer. Write your answers on the lines and keep within the large pink
box on each page. If you write the answer outside the pink box, that part of the answer may not be
scanned or marked.
If you make a mistake, completely fill in the question number box and draw a line through the text already
written. Use the next available pair of boxes. Always leave 1 blank line between two answers. This might
mean you may have to skip one pair of boxes and subsequent 8 lines. Examiners will no longer mark a
full subject paper but concentrate on one particular question only. This ensures consistent marking
across groups of candidates. It is therefore of the utmost importance that the scanners can clearly identify
where your answer starts and ends. If in doubt, start each question on a new page. Samples are given in
the “IB Answer booklet guide 2015” stored in the Google doc folder “IB M15 General Exam Info”. All IB
candidates have access to this folder via the personalized google folder shared with the exams office.

Bad Weather
All public examinations will proceed as scheduled with the exception of:
Tropical Cyclone Number 8 signal or higher
Examinations will be postponed. Announcements are made on TV and on our school website. Check the
school website for news on the cancellation and possible rescheduled day and time. Rescheduled exams
can fall on a Saturday or a public holiday.
Black Rainstorm signal
Examinations will be postponed until later in the day. Check the school website for an announcement.
On days with adverse weather conditions, always check the school website and listen to the public
announcements on TV and radio before leaving home. Such Announcements are made:
Morning examination sessions: between 6 a.m. and 8 a.m.
Afternoon examination sessions: between 11 a.m. and 2 p.m.
Evening examination sessions: between 4 p.m. and 6 p.m.
If an exam is delayed because of bad weather
DO NOT USE SOCIAL MEDIA NETWORKS, EMAIL OR PHONE Have a family member to assist you. To prevent exam paper security leaks, you must be supervised by an
adult from the normal start time of the exam and refrain from talking or communicating with other exam
candidates. We will reschedule the missed exam(s) as soon as it is safe to travel. All ESF secondary schools
coordinate the new start time of the exams once the HK Observatory has lowered the signals. Request a
family member to monitor the HK Observatory notifications and WIS school website. New exam times will be
published on our school website (www.wis.edu.hk). Proceed to school if travel is safe. Generally speaking, all
missed exams will be taken on the affected day as much as possible. If the signal is lowered late afternoon,
exams might be postponed to the next day (including public holiday or Saturday).

Enquiry Upon Results (EuR) (also known as “remark request”) Your grade may go up or go down as a result of an Enquiry Upon Results.
Deadline : 15 September 2015
Fee : to be confirmed (approx.. HK$800 - per subject)
Note : From 11 July to 2 August – service only available from Monday to Wednesday
Exam Officer will be on leave and Post 16 Curriculum Administrator only works from Mon-Wed
EuR available for EuR not available for
All written exams Multiple Choice papers
TOK essay Internal Assessment components
Extended Essay
Year 13 Leavers Booklet Exams Office
9
A EuR or remark request will automatically result in the review of all written components (excluding multiple
choice papers and internal assessment) within the subject. Please note that your grade may go up or go down
as a result of an Enquiry Upon Results.
